Output d84a99c701de35940b1714c9f3a73e127c663ae2c7dec219fa8b7f9bdf24d0e9:0

value
136411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677cc827c8b8eb479dde18f0728cb0a5599b74b2 OP_EQUAL
address
3B8D1JDkZWoH6csbCASxE5aFR9dzfnTnsf
transaction
d84a99c701de35940b1714c9f3a73e127c663ae2c7dec219fa8b7f9bdf24d0e9
confirmations
207027
spent
true